On Thu, Dec 08, 2016 at 12:08:53PM -0800, Linus Torvalds wrote: > Especially since that's some of the ugliest inline asm ever due to the > nasty BX handling.
Yeah, about that: why doesn't gcc handle that for us like it would handle a clobbered register? I mean, it *should* know that BX is live when building with -fPIC... The .ifnc thing looks really silly.
